Coloring tips: How to color Football Player Running coloring page well?
Try using bright colors for the football player's uniform, such as red, blue, or green, to make the picture stand out. The helmet can be colored in a shiny silver or match the jersey's color. Use brown or orange for the football to give it a realistic look. For the skin, you can choose any tone you like. The shoes and socks can be white or black with some stripes for more detail. Keep your coloring inside the lines to make the picture neat. You can also add shadows by using a darker shade to show the player's muscles and clothes folds.
